<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0">
  <channel>
    <link>http://xgu.ru/hg/lilalo/</link>
    <language>en-us</language>

    <title>lilalo: lm-install history</title>
    <description>lm-install revision history</description>
    <item>
    <title>Небольшие исправления</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[Небольшие исправления]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Fri, 27 Jan 2006 09:53:10 +0200</pubDate>
</item>
<item>
    <title>l3: Добавил небольшое оформление и строчку &quot;Инструтор&quot; в индекс</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[l3: Добавил небольшое оформление и строчку &quot;Инструтор&quot; в индекс<br/>
lm-install: Убрал ошибочно закомментированный login_from для FreeBSD]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Tue, 22 Nov 2005 22:45:45 +0200</pubDate>
</item>
<item>
    <title>1) В случае, если команда является повторяющейся,</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[1) В случае, если команда является повторяющейся,<br/>
показывать только последнюю версию команды.<br/>
2) lm-install неправильно определял hostname в  FreeBSD. Исправлено.]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Tue, 22 Nov 2005 20:46:46 +0200</pubDate>
</item>
<item>
    <title>lm-install:</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[lm-install:<br/>
	Инсталляция запуска l3-agent в .bash_profile]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Mon, 14 Nov 2005 09:17:49 +0200</pubDate>
</item>
<item>
    <title>l3-frontend:</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[l3-frontend:<br/>
	Добавлена поддержка фильтрации по пользователю (user) и хосту (hostname).<br/>
	Пока только прототип - нужно оптимизировать.<br/>
	И нужно стандартизировать имена для полей<br/>
<br/>
l3-cgi:<br/>
	В current теперь могут быть подразделы]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Mon, 14 Nov 2005 07:42:57 +0200</pubDate>
</item>
<item>
    <title>Выполнены шаги 4,5 в плане N05 по построению распределённой системы lilalo.</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[Выполнены шаги 4,5 в плане N05 по построению распределённой системы lilalo.<br/>
Шаг &lt;6&gt; в настоящее время не является необходимым.<br/>
<br/>
<br/>
Введено понятие сеанса.<br/>
Сеансом считается процедура работы с системой, начинающаяся с регистрации<br/>
в ней и зазаканчивающаяся разрегистрацией, и сопровождающаяся ведением одного<br/>
файла скрипта.<br/>
Одновременно с созданием скрипта (.script) создаётся соответствующий ему<br/>
файл с информацией о сеансе (.info).<br/>
Каждый сеанс имеет уникальный в пределах хоста идентификатор,<br/>
~local_session_id~, который впоследствии позволяет определить,<br/>
какие команды относятся к какому сеансу.<br/>
<br/>
Добавлен backend-сервер, который получает данные от агентов и записывает<br/>
из в backend (в настойщий момент - в XML-файл).<br/>
Данные передаются по tcp-соединениям.<br/>
(Одновременно может работать несколько серверов.<br/>
Блокировка файла при записи пока что не выполняется ОСТОРОЖНО!!!!!!)<br/>
<br/>
Агент периодически пытается отправить backend-серверу содержимое своего кэш-файла,<br/>
и если ему это удаётся, кэш файл очищается -- данные теперь хранятся в backend'е.<br/>
<br/>
Взаимодействие агентов, backend-сервера и frontend'а<br/>
сейчас выполнеятся так:<br/>
<br/>
<br/>
          +-------+<br/>
          |       |<br/>
          | cache |<br/>
          |       |<br/>
          +-^---+-+<br/>
            |   |<br/>
	    . ^ v            . ^^ .      +---------+      . ^^ .<br/>
	  /       \  tcp   /        \    |         |    /        \  CGI<br/>
	 (  agent  )-----&gt;( backend- )--&gt;| backend |--&gt;( frontend )-----&gt;<br/>
	  \       /        \ сервер /    |         |    \        /<br/>
	    ' . '            ' .. '      +---------+      ' .. '<br/>
              ^<br/>
              |<br/>
         +----+----+<br/>
         |         |<br/>
         |*.script |<br/>
         | *.info  |<br/>
         |         |<br/>
         +---------+<br/>
<br/>
l3-frontend:<br/>
	Теперь может выдавать результат работы на стандартный поток вывода.<br/>
	Вместо имени файла нужно указать символ -<br/>
<br/>
Добавлены файлы:<br/>
<br/>
	l3-backend	-	backend-сервер<br/>
	l3-cgi		-	CGI-обвязка для l3-frontend'а<br/>
<br/>
Новые конфигурационные параметры:<br/>
	frontend_css		Путь к файлу CSS, используемому в HTML-странице, которую генерирует frontend<br/>
	frontend_google_ico	Путь к иконке google<br/>
	frontend_linux_ico	Путь к иконке linux<br/>
	frontend_freebsd_ico	Путь к иконке freebsd<br/>
	frontend_opennet_ico	Путь к иконке opennet<br/>
	frontend_local_ico	Путь к иконке локальной документации<br/>
<br/>
	backend_address		IP-адрес интерфейса, на котором работает backend-сервер<br/>
	backend_port		Порт, который слушает backend-сервер<br/>
	backend_pidfile		Путь к файлу, который хранит идентификатор процесса backend-сервера<br/>
	backend_datafile	Путь к файлу хранилищу (файлу backend)]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Mon, 07 Nov 2005 11:24:49 +0200</pubDate>
</item>
<item>
    <title>lm-install: проверка операционной системы на стороне клиента.</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[lm-install: проверка операционной системы на стороне клиента.<br/>
В зависимости от того FreeBSD это или Linux<br/>
нужно по-разному запускать script]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Tue, 28 Jun 2005 09:16:07 +0300</pubDate>
</item>
<item>
    <title>Приглашение перенесено и поставлено перед if</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[Приглашение перенесено и поставлено перед if]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Thu, 16 Jun 2005 11:44:38 +0300</pubDate>
</item>
<item>
    <title>export PS1</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[export PS1]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Fri, 03 Jun 2005 09:53:28 +0300</pubDate>
</item>
<item>
    <title>Изменил пути к репозиторию lilalo</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[Изменил пути к репозиторию lilalo]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Fri, 03 Jun 2005 09:43:48 +0300</pubDate>
</item>
<item>
    <title>lm-install поправлен.</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[lm-install поправлен.<br/>
	* Исправлено вычисление имени пользователя<br/>
	  для chown ~/.labmaker после инсталляции.<br/>
	* Ничего не добавляется в профайл, всё чере basrhc<br/>
	* PS1 меняется до exec]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Sun, 29 May 2005 12:40:51 +0300</pubDate>
</item>
<item>
    <title>Initial revision</title>
    <link>http://xgu.ru/hg/lilalo/log}/lm-install</link>
    <description><![CDATA[Initial revision]]></description>
    <author>&#100;&#101;&#118;&#105;</author>
    <pubDate>Sun, 22 May 2005 16:29:55 +0300</pubDate>
</item>

  </channel>
</rss>
